In his first season in Kansas City last year, Morton was assigned to the flanker position. Lined up a yard and a half off the ball for the first time in his life, Morton felt like a stranger in a strange land, and he had his least productive year in eight seasons.
In the offseason, instead of writing off Morton, Vermeil and Saunders moved him back to split end. "It''s like home for me," says Morton, who made four outstanding catches against the Ravens.
Hopefully, Morton continues to make similar plays today.
